Class IX, XI students failing in 1-2 papers to be promoted: Goa board
Representative image
PANAJI: All Class IX and XI students, who were eligible to answer supplementary exams for the academic year 2019-20, have been promoted to Class X and XII respectively, Goa Board of Secondary and Higher Secondary Education has said in a circular issued on Friday. This means that only students who have failed in one or two subjects in Class IX and XI will be eligible to be promoted to a higher class.
Earlier, chief minister Pramod Sawant, after a meeting with education officials, had already announced that it has been decided to cancel the supplementary exams held every year in June for students of Class IX and XI due to the pandemic.

Those eligible for exams can be promoted: Goa Board
But while Sawant had said that all students would be promoted to the higher class, the board circular states that only those eligible for the supplementary exams would be promoted.
Students who have failed in one or two subjects only are eligible to answer the supplementary exams.
“I am directed to inform that supplementary examination for the academic year 2019-20 for Class IX and XI stand cancelled. All students who were eligible for supplementary exams for the academic year 2019-20 shall be promoted to higher class (X or XII),” states the board circular.
Parents had demanded a decision on the supplementary exams so that students who have failed in one or two subjects know where they stand and they can attend the ongoing online classes accordingly.
But after Sawant had announced cancellation of the supplementary exams, many teachers had raised objections to the decision to promote all students to the higher class.
Teachers had said that this would lead to confusion as some students are especially weak. But as per the Goa Board circular, now only those who have failed in one or two subjects will be promoted to the higher class.
